  • Mayan Ruins

    The Yucatan is home to numerous ancient Mayan ruins, such as Chichen Itza, Uxmal, and Tulum. These sites offer a glimpse into the rich history and culture of the Mayan civilization.

  • Swimming Cenotes

    Cenotes are natural sinkholes filled with crystal-clear water. The Yucatan has hundreds of these unique swimming holes, such as Gran Cenote and Cenote Ik Kil, where you can dive into refreshing waters surrounded by lush jungle.

  • Flora and Fauna

    The Yucatan is a haven for nature lovers. The region is home to a diverse range of flora and fauna, including exotic birds, iguanas, and even the elusive jaguar. The Sian Ka’an Biosphere Reserve is a must-visit for those interested in exploring the natural beauty of the area.
